Orientations

All new volunteers are invited to attend a general orientation session.  This orientation session will provide basic information and handouts on the many different opportunities and policies for the volunteer positions at Good Mews.

Once you attend the orientation, you will work with a member of the committee you signed up for to determine where your efforts can best be applied.  Please note that some positions require training before you can begin volunteering.

Petsmart Charities

Good Mews has been awarded a $6,000 grant for the support and expansion of our foster care program.

Our Grant Committee applied for it last November and just received notification of the award. 

This sum will go a long way toward caring for more abandoned and abused kitties in the coming year and we are grateful to the Petsmart Charities Foundation for their generosity and to our Grant Committee for their continuing efforts to secure funding for Good Mews.
